Abraham has won his undying fame not because of any “work” which he did, but 
because he believed that something that was obviously “dead” would live 
immediately (pre-day-of-resurrection) because of the promise of the Lord. And 
that was his “dead” sexual powers to sire offspring.

 

“Abraham believed God, and it [his faith] was counted unto him for 
righteousness” (Rom. 4:3).

 

But what was it that he believed?

 

“Against hope [he] believed in hope, that he might become the father of many 
nations, according to that which was spoken, So shall thy seed be” (vs. 18).

 

The normal unbelief of all mankind (in the face of God’s promise) ridiculed the 
idea that anyone as old as he was could function sexually and sire offspring; 
he was “dead.”

 

But God had said “I have made thee a father of many nations,” past-present 
tense. It’s already been done! (vs. 17). Nothing physical “told” Abraham that 
it was true; he had nothing to depend on except the naked promise of God which 
unbelief said was foolhardy. But chose to believe!

 

It was an effort of choice that Abraham made to believe what God had said when 
everything looked impossible.

 

And not only was Abraham called to believe that his own “dead” body could sire 
offspring; there was “the deadness of Sarah’s womb”(vs. 19) to be confronted. 
Abraham had to believe for himself and then he also had to believe for her! “He 
staggered not at the promise of God through unbelief; but was strong in faith, 
giving glory to God” (vs. 20).

 

The entire unfallen universe marveled at his faith and glorified God because of 
it. They rejoiced that now it was proven for all to see, that fallen, sinful, 
naturally unbelieving man, can overcome and can think and believe in harmony 
with the mind of God.

 

The salvation of the fallen human race was assured now!
